#68e1ad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68e1ad is composed of 40.8% red, 88.2% green and 67.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 154.2 degrees, a saturation of 66.9% and a lightness of 64.5%. #68e1ad color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#00c35b.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#68e1ad

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030d08 is the darkest color, while #fbf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#68e1ad

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a0a9a5 is the less saturated color, while #4cfdb1 is the most saturated one.
